Understanding Your Quilt Before Caring for It

Before you wash or store your quilt, it’s important to understand what it’s made of. Different materials need different care.

Common Quilt Materials

  • Cotton Quilts – Breathable, lightweight, and perfect for Indian climates
  • Microfiber Quilts – Soft, wrinkle-resistant, and easy to maintain
  • Blended Quilts – Combine durability with comfort
  • Hand-stitched or Designer Quilts – Require gentle handling

📌 Pro Tip: Always check the care label attached to your quilt before washing.

Daily Quilt Care Tips for Long-Lasting Freshness

Small daily habits can significantly extend the life of your quilt.

1. Air Your Quilt Regularly

Let your quilt breathe by airing it out once a week in indirect sunlight. This prevents moisture buildup and unpleasant odors.

2. Use a Quilt Cover

A removable quilt cover protects your quilt from:

  • Sweat
  • Dust
  • Spills
  • Body oils

This reduces the need for frequent washing.

3. Avoid Sitting or Folding Repeatedly

Consistent pressure in one area can flatten the filling and reduce insulation.


How Often Should You Wash Your Quilt?

One of the most common questions people ask is:
“How often should I wash my quilt?”

Ideal Washing Frequency

  • With quilt cover: Every 3–4 months
  • Without quilt cover: Every 1–2 months
  • Heavily used quilts: Once a month

Overwashing can damage fibers, so balance is key.

Step-by-Step Guide to Washing Your Quilt

Machine Washing Your Quilt

✔ Use a large-capacity washing machine
✔ Select gentle or delicate cycle
✔ Wash with cold or lukewarm water
✔ Use mild liquid detergent

🚫 Avoid bleach or harsh chemicals — they weaken fabric fibers.

Hand Washing Your Quilt

  1. Best for delicate or handcrafted quilts:
  2. Fill a bathtub with lukewarm water
  3. Add mild detergent
  4. Gently press (do not wring)
  5. Rinse thoroughly

Drying Your Quilt the Right Way

Improper drying can ruin even the best quilt.

Air Drying (Best Option)

  • Lay flat on a clean surface
  • Flip occasionally for even drying
  • Avoid direct harsh sunlight

Tumble Drying

✔ Use low heat only
✔ Add dryer balls to maintain fluff
🚫 High heat can shrink and damage filling

Seasonal Quilt Care: Summer vs Winter

Summer Care Tips

  • Use lightweight quilts
  • Store heavy quilts properly
  • Wash before storing to avoid odor buildup

Winter Care Tips

  • Shake quilts daily to retain loft
  • Avoid moisture exposure
  • Use breathable storage solutions

How to Store Your Quilt Properly

Improper storage is one of the biggest reasons quilts lose quality.

Best Storage Practices

✔ Store in cotton or breathable fabric bags
✔ Keep in a cool, dry place
✔ Add natural repellents like neem leaves or lavender

🚫 Never store quilts in plastic bags — they trap moisture and cause mildew.

Common Quilt Care Mistakes to Avoid

  • Using hot water
  • Overloading washing machines
  • Skipping drying completely
  • Folding the same way every time
  • Ignoring care labels

Avoiding these mistakes alone can double the life of your quilt.

FAQs

1. How do I keep my quilt soft after washing?

Use mild detergent, avoid fabric softeners, and dry on low heat or air dry.

2. Can quilts be dry cleaned?

Some quilts can be dry cleaned, but frequent dry cleaning may reduce fabric lifespan. Always check the care label.

3. Why does my quilt smell after storage?

This usually happens due to trapped moisture. Always wash and fully dry quilts before storing.

4. Is sunlight good for quilts?

Indirect sunlight helps remove moisture and odors, but direct harsh sunlight can fade colors.

5. How long do quality quilts last?

With proper care, premium quilts can last 5–10 years or more.
